I searched the depths of the internet and found the secrets of Sylvie's tight body:
– Sylvie Meis works out twice a week with her personal trainer.
She does one-legged squats (that's how she gets those tight peach-shaped buttocks) and push-ups. Additionally, she trains with a large ball and works on her abs that way.
– Don't think that this sports regime ends here. No, at home, Sylvie does her own exercises five times a week: 20 minutes of cardio and 20 minutes of strength training.
– As for Sylvie's diet; candy, chips, and cookies are (unfortunately) excluded.
Healthy carbohydrates like rice, whole grain bread, and grains are allowed in moderation. If she has sweet cravings, she makes a healthy pancake with a banana and two eggs. A tip she got from a friend.
– Sylvie drinks green tea like crazy and avoids alcohol (except for the occasional party glass). Although that last point is something Syl, I would like to negotiate with you about.
